#6c0834 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c0834 is composed of 42.4% red, 3.1%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.6% magenta, 51.9%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 333.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 22.7%. #6c0834 color hex could be obtained by blending #d81068 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

● #6c0834 color description : Very dark pink.
#6c0834 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c0834 has RGB values of R:108, G:8,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.52,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7079988.
